What does readme file means?

What does readme file means?

A README file contains information about the other files in a directory or archive of computer software. A form of documentation, it is usually a simple plain text file called README , Read Me , READ.ME , README. TXT , README.md (to indicate the use of Markdown), or README.

What is txt file called?

A TXT file is a standard text document that contains plain text. It can be opened and edited in any text-editing or word-processing program. TXT files are most often created by Microsoft Notepad and Apple TextEdit, which are basic text editors that come bundled with Windows and macOS, respectively. PAGES files.

What is the use of README txt?

A README file is a text file (commonly readme. txt) containing information for the user about the software program, utility, or game. README files often contain instructions and additional help, and details about patches or updates.

Why is readme capitalized?

Traditionally the file was called README in uppercase because command-line environments that use alphabetical ordering would then put the file at the top. This makes them easily visible in big directories.

How is a text file stored in memory?

All data values in a plain text file are stored as a series of characters. Even numbers are stored as characters. Each character is stored in computer memory as one or two bytes.

Should readme be txt?

Write your readme document as a plain text file To avoid proprietary formats such as MS Word whenever possible. Format the readme document so it is easy to understand (e.g. separate important pieces of information with blank lines, rather than having all the information in one long paragraph).

Should readme be TXT or MD?

md is markdown . README.md is used to generate the html summary you see at the bottom of projects. Github has their own flavor of Markdown. Order of Preference: If you have two files named README and README.md , the file named README.md is preferred, and it will be used to generate github’s html summary.
